hand of salvation takes some getting used to for pallies, but once we figure it out it should prevent this from happening. the key is to watch high threat on omen , which we didn't usually have to do as healers (especially as pallies because our threat is usually so low). we had no mechanics for high threat before, "You have salv. What's your deal?" so we just spam heals if you take aggro.
This Hand deal lets you be buffed with your normal (wisdom/kings/might) whatever and still get another buff from the same pally. As we see someone surpassing or closing in on the tank , you throw up a hand of salv on them and it should decrease their threat while decreasing their damage output. this is how it worked in the beta anyways.
